Garage Door Banging Noise
Banging sounds are often caused by unbalanced doors. It's important to get this problem repaired sooner rather than later to prevent other damage from happening.
Weather Stripping Repair
As your garage door gets older, the weather stripping or trim may deteriorate and need replacement. Repairing the weather stripping will help insulate your garage and keep undesirable animals out.
Rattling Garage Door Sounds
Rattling noises may be the result of loose nuts or bolts, dry parts needing lubrication , misaligned doors, or a garage door opener that was not correctly put in.
Garage Door Scraping Sounds
Scraping sounds are often due to unbalanced doors.
Squeaking Garage Door
Squeaking noises might be due to a loose roller or hinge, parts needing oiling, or misaligned doors.
Rubbing Sound Garage Door
Rubbing could be the result of bent tracks or a jammed or tight track which needs fixing.
Grinding Noise Garage Door
Grinding sounds might be caused by parts needing grease, loose rollers or hinges, a stripped garage door opener gear, or an incorrectly hung opener.
Slapping Garage Door Noise
Slapping sounds are often caused by a loose chain.
Vibrating Garage Door Sound
Vibrating noises are generally caused by loose parts or rollers needing lubrication.
Popping Noise Garage Door
Popping sounds might be caused by torsion spring problems.

Garage Door Opener Installation
The normal lifespan of a garage door opener is approximately 10-15 years. Routine maintenance, greasing, and making certain your garage door is balanced will aid in extending the lifespan of your opener. For safety reasons, if you have a garage door opener that was built before 1993, it’s always recommended to have it replaced and not repaired.
